Facility for highlighting documents accessed through search or browsing
First Claim
1. A computer implemented method of enhancing query results provided independent of a search engine, the method comprising:
- sending a query to an independent search engine;
receiving query results from the search engine; and
generating information regarding relevancy of the query results based at least in part upon a user model and independent of the search engine.
2 Assignments
0 Petitions
Accused Products
Abstract
An information highlighting facility assists the user in evaluating relevance of accessed documents to the user'"'"'s information need. The accessed documents may, for example, be identified by a search engine in response to a user query. When accessing documents identified as relevant by a search engine from other networked computers, the facility provides information highlighting to assist the user in determining whether the document is relevant. A model of the user'"'"'s interest, which may include an augmented set of search terms, is used to take into account the general interest of the user as captured by an interest profile and context of use of the computer by the user, or a combination thereof. The model of the user'"'"'s interest is applied to the document text as the document is accessed from its source. The highlighting of information about the document content may include highlighting of the terminology in the text, scrolling of the document to the relevant passages, identification of entity names and entity relations, creation of a document summary and a document thumbnail, etc. In addition, the model can be applied to a set of documents accessed by the user, e.g., to re-rank the top scoring documents from the result set provided to the user by a search engine or some other information providing services.
-
Citations
20 Claims
-
1. A computer implemented method of enhancing query results provided independent of a search engine, the method comprising:
-
sending a query to an independent search engine;
receiving query results from the search engine; and
generating information regarding relevancy of the query results based at least in part upon a user model and independent of the search engine.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er implemented method of enhancing query results provided independent of a search engine, the method comprising:
-
sending a query to an independent search engine;
creating a context based at least in part upon a user model;
receiving query results from the search engine; and
generating information regarding relevancy of the query results independent of the search engine and based upon the context.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A computer system for enhancing query results provided independent of a search engine, the system comprising:
-
a module that sends a query to a search engine separate from the computer;
a module that receives query results from the search engine;
a module that retrieves documents identified by the query results;
a module that enhances the query based at least in part upon a user model;
a module that applies the enhanced query to the retrieved documents; and
a module that generates information regarding relevancy of the retrieved documents based at least in part upon the enhanced query and the user model. - View Dependent Claims (17, 18, 19, 20)
-
Specification